Alex Marquez undergoes successful surgery after Dutch GP crash

Alex Marquez undergoes successful surgery after Dutch GP crash

Alex Marquez has undergone successful surgical procedure for his left hand injury — resulting from an incident with Pedro Acosta at last week’s Dutch GP.

Gresini team confirmed that the second-placed MotoGP championship rider has completed surgery for the second metacarpal fracture of his left hand. The decision about his participation in next week’s German GP remains pending further evaluation.

Meanwhile, Luca Marini is set to return to his Honda for private testing in Brno — a month after a serious accident in Suzuka that resulted in pneumothorax and multiple contusions.

Joan Mir who was supposed to join the test remains uncertain about his participation — following a collision with Fermin Aldeguer’s Gresini Ducati at the Dutch GP. Though CT scan showed no clavicle fracture, doctors advised rest due to the severe impact.

Alex Rins and Miguel Oliveira will represent Yamaha in the private test exclusively for Honda and Yamaha teams.
